FindBugs Bug Detector Report

The following document contains the results of FindBugs Report

FindBugs Version is 1.3.9

Threshold is medium

Effort is min

Summary

ClassesBugsErrorsMissing Classes
64800

org.kuali.rice.krms.framework.engine.TermResolutionEngineImpl$1

BugCategoryDetailsLinePriority
Unread field: org.kuali.rice.krms.framework.engine.TermResolutionEngineImpl$1.dest; should this field be static?PERFORMANCESS_SHOULD_BE_STATIC336Medium

org.kuali.rice.krms.framework.engine.result.BasicResult

BugCategoryDetailsLinePriority
new org.kuali.rice.krms.framework.engine.result.BasicResult(String, Object, ExecutionEnvironment, boolean) invokes inefficient Boolean constructor; use Boolean.valueOf(...) insteadPERFORMANCEDM_BOOLEAN_CTOR60Medium
new org.kuali.rice.krms.framework.engine.result.BasicResult(String, String, Object, ExecutionEnvironment, boolean) invokes inefficient Boolean constructor; use Boolean.valueOf(...) insteadPERFORMANCEDM_BOOLEAN_CTOR54Medium
new org.kuali.rice.krms.framework.engine.result.BasicResult(Map, String, String, Object, ExecutionEnvironment, boolean) invokes inefficient Boolean constructor; use Boolean.valueOf(...) insteadPERFORMANCEDM_BOOLEAN_CTOR48Medium
Class org.kuali.rice.krms.framework.engine.result.BasicResult defines non-transient non-serializable instance field environmentBAD_PRACTICESE_BAD_FIELDMedium

org.kuali.rice.krms.framework.engine.result.TimingResult

BugCategoryDetailsLinePriority
org.kuali.rice.krms.framework.engine.result.TimingResult.getResult() has Boolean return type and returns explicit nullBAD_PRACTICENP_BOOLEAN_RETURN_NULL79Medium
Class org.kuali.rice.krms.framework.engine.result.TimingResult defines non-transient non-serializable instance field environmentBAD_PRACTICESE_BAD_FIELDMedium
Unwritten field: org.kuali.rice.krms.framework.engine.result.TimingResult.resultDetailsCORRECTNESSUWF_UNWRITTEN_FIELD94Medium